Many common issues faced by parking lot owners are addressed through these services. Cracks and potholes can develop over time due to weather conditions, heavy traffic, or ground shifting, leading to further deterioration if left untreated. Water infiltration through cracks can cause underlying soil erosion or freeze-thaw damage, exacerbating the problem. Sealing and patching help prevent water penetration, reducing damage and maintaining the structural integrity of the surface. Additionally, resurfacing can restore a parking lot’s appearance and provide a fresh, smooth surface that improves cur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Parking Lot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Citrus Heights,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a new concrete parking lot ranges from $4 to $8 per square foot, depending on size and complexity. For example, a 1,000-square-foot lot might cost between $4,000 and $8,000. Local service providers can provide estimates based on project specifics.
Repair Expenses - Repair costs for cracks or surface damage generally fall between $300 and $1,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or crack filling may be on the lower end, while extensive resurfacing can approach the higher range. Prices vary by contractor and project scope.
Resurfacing Costs - Resurfacing a concrete parking lot typically costs between $3 and $7 per square foot, with larger areas potentially reducing per-square-foot expenses. For a 2,000-square-foot lot, expect costs from $6,000 to $14,000. Local pros can assess specific needs for accurate pricing.
Sealant Application - Applying sealant to protect a concrete parking lot usually costs $0.15 to $0.30 per square foot. For a standard lot, this could amount to $300 to $600. Sealant services help prolong the lifespan of the surface and are recommended periodically.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
